Attention: From Theory to Practice - Human Technology Interaction Series
How can these researchers in human-technology interaction take advantage of all the knowledge amassed on attention in basic-science research? This volume addresses this question and includes a comprehensive introduction on briding theory and practice in the psychology of attention and a conclusion outlining a future research agenda.
